Adding Trauma Bag

I recently came across a Trauma Bag that's not listed here. I didn't see it in the variation of the Duffel Bag either but it has different stats as well. I found it in the back on an ambulance.

Trauma Bag.png
  • Encumbrance: 1.0
  • Capacity: 23
  • Encumbrance Reduction: 65

Items it came with:

  • Surgical Gloves
  • Suture Needle Holder
  • Tweezers
